The postcode B31 2FD is located in Birmingham, in the county of West Midlands. It was introduced in December 1997 and is an active postcode. B31 2FD is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

B31 2FD is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of B31 2FD as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.

The closest road name to B31 2FD is Lady Bracknell Mews which is centered 13 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Lindsey Ave and is 94 m away. The closest railway station is Northfield Rail Station, 1.18 km away.

The closest primary school to B31 2FD (for ages 11 and under) is St Laurence Church Junior School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on May 23,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St Thomas Aquinas Catholic School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 8, 2018 rated this school as Good

Residents reported an average download speed of 95.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 10 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for B31 2FD is covered by the West Midlands police force association and South Birmingham is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
